| As of 2007, Sun City's population is 21,417 people.
Since 2000, it has had a population growth of 20.50 percent. The
median home cost in Sun City is $265,000. Home appreciation the last
year has been 0.00 percent.
Compared to the rest of the country, Sun City's cost of living is
0.67% Lower than the U.S. average.
Sun City public schools spend $4,662 per student. The average school
expenditure in the U.S. is $6,058. There are about 20 students per
teacher in Sun City.
The unemployment rate in Sun City is 5.20 percent(U.S. avg. is
4.60%). Recent job growth is Positive. Sun City jobs have Increased by
3.07 percent.

Health
There are 116 physicians per capita in Sun City, CA. The US average
is 170.
Sun City, CA Health Index
Air quality in Sun City, CA is 13 on a scale to 100 (higher is
better). This is based on ozone alert days and number of pollutants in
the air, as reported by the EPA.
Water quality in Sun City, CA is 50 on a scale to 100 (higher is
better). The EPA has a complex method of measuring watershed quality
using 15 indicators.
Superfund index is 10 on a scale to 100 (higher is better). This is
upon the number and impact of EPA Superfund pollution sites in the
county, including spending on the cleanup efforts.
Crime
Sun City, CA, violent crime, on a scale from 1 (low crime) to 10, is
4. Violent crime is composed of four offenses: murder and nonnegligent
manslaughter, forcible rape, robbery, and aggravated assault. The US
average is 3.
Sun City, CA, property crime, on a scale from 1 (low) to 10, is 6.
Property crime includes the offenses of burglary, larceny-theft, motor
vehicle theft, and arson. The object of the theft-type offenses is the
taking of money or property, but there is no force or threat of force
against the victims. The US average is 3.

Climate
Sun City, CA, gets 11 inches of rain per year. The US average is 37.
Snowfall is 0 inches. The average US city gets 25 inches of snow per
year. The number of days with any measurable precipitation is 31.
On average, there are 276 sunny days per year in Sun City, CA. The
July high is around 97 degrees. The January low is 36. Our comfort
index, which is based on humidity during the hot months, is a 18 out of
100, where higher is more comfortable. The US average on the comfort
index is 44.
